Maison > développement back-end > Tutoriel Python > Comment saisir un tableau à partir du clavier en python

Comment saisir un tableau à partir du clavier en python

下次还敢
Libérer: 2024-05-05 19:51:48
original
1198 Les gens l'ont consulté

Obtenez la saisie du clavier de l'utilisateur via la fonction input(), utilisez split(',') pour séparer l'entrée en une liste par des virgules, et enfin utilisez np.array() pour convertir la liste en un tableau NumPy.

Comment saisir un tableau à partir du clavier en python

Utiliser Python pour saisir un tableau à partir du clavier

Comment utiliser Python pour saisir un tableau à partir du clavier ?

En utilisant la fonction input() de Python, vous pouvez obtenir un tableau de saisies utilisateur à partir du clavier. input() 函数,您可以从键盘获取用户输入的数组。

详细步骤:

  1. 导入 numpy 库:
<code class="python">import numpy as np</code>
Copier après la connexion
  1. 使用 input() 获取用户的输入:
<code class="python">user_input = input("请输入数组元素,用逗号分隔:")</code>
Copier après la connexion
  1. 将用户输入的字符串转换为列表:
<code class="python">user_list = user_input.split(',')</code>
Copier après la connexion
  1. 使用 numpy.array()
Étapes détaillées :

  1. Importer la bibliothèque numpy :

<code class="python">array = np.array(user_list, dtype=int)</code>
Copier après la connexion
  1. Utiliser input() Obtenez la saisie de l'utilisateur :

    <code class="python">import numpy as np
    
    user_input = input("请输入数组元素,用逗号分隔:")
    user_list = user_input.split(',')
    array = np.array(user_list, dtype=int)
    
    print(array)</code>
    Copier après la connexion
    1. Convertissez la chaîne saisie par l'utilisateur en liste :

    <code>[1 2 3 4 5]</code>
    Copier après la connexion
    1. Utiliseznumpy. array () Convertir la liste en tableau NumPy : 🎜🎜rrreee🎜🎜Exemple de code : 🎜🎜rrreee🎜🎜Sortie : 🎜🎜rrreee

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al